Community Profile
Nestled in the heart of Palm Beach County, a unique community boasts an impressive $128,125 median household income, significantly higher than the national average. This affluent neighborhood is characterized by a high percentage of 67.4% of households earning six-figure incomes, making it an attractive destination for professionals and families seeking a thriving lifestyle. The community's 91% homeownership rate is also noteworthy, indicating a strong sense of stability and investment in the area. With a median home value of $689,183, residents can expect to find beautiful and well-maintained properties. The population's demographics reveal a fascinating mix, with 23.2% of residents aged 65 and above, suggesting a strong presence of retirees who appreciate the area's tranquil atmosphere and amenities.
The community's educated workforce is another notable aspect, with 29.1%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her, and an impressive 37.9% of STEM degree holders. The average commute time of 21.7 minutes is relatively short, allowing residents to easily access nearby cities and amenities. Weather Overview in Glen Ridge, Florida
Glen Ridge, Florida, has a humid subtropical climate, characterized by mild winters and hot, humid summers. The approximate seasonal temperature ranges are: summer highs around 90°F (32°C) and lows around 70°F (21°C), while winter highs are around 70°F (21°C) and lows around 50°F (10°C).
Precipitation patterns in Glen Ridge are influenced by its location, with most of the rainfall occurring during the summer months. The region experiences a significant amount of sunshine throughout the year, with an average of 205 sunny days. The weather in Glen Ridge is also affected by its coastal proximity, which can lead to occasional sea breezes and increased humidity.

Glen Ridge Market Analytics
The Glen Ridge housing market is showing signs of balance, with the average home value at $467,364, down 2.8% over the past year, indicating a slight cooling of the market. According to data analyzed by Opulist, the market sale-to-list ratio is at 0.958, suggesting that homes are selling for approximately 95.8% of their listed price, and with 83.9% of sales happening below list price, it's a good time for buyers to negotiate.
